OpenAI выпустил в этот мир невероятный ИИ - GitHub CoPilot. Помощник по программированию на базе искусственного интеллекта, который намного более эффективен, чем обычные функции автозаполнения IDE. Это должна быть одна из самых крутых систем искусственного интеллекта. Смотрите здесь.

CoPilot все еще находится на стадии тестирования, и вы можете подать заявку на участие в тестировании. Как упоминалось на веб-сайте, OpenAI планирует со временем монетизировать эту систему (О, НЕТ!). Мне повезло, что меня приняли в качестве тестировщика. Вот как вы продолжаете с ним болтать.

Примечание. GitHub CoPilot обучен на миллиардах строк кода и не предназначен для общения в чате. Эта функция может быть прекращена в этой функции. Это всего лишь эксперимент, чтобы увидеть, какая информация и какие предубеждения закодированы в системе.

Как настроить чат с CoPilot?

  1. Подать заявку на технический превью здесь
  2. После того, как вас примут в качестве тестировщика, установите расширение CoPilot в Visual Studio Code.
  3. Откройте новый файл с расширением .yaml
  4. Начните задавать вопросы в формате ниже
    Я: ‹Question›
    AI:

    и CoPilot с автозаполнением для вас!

Если ответы повторяются, откройте новый файл или воспользуйтесь подсказками для CoPilot, как показано ниже.
Обратите внимание, что я не использовал никаких подсказок для двух фрагментов в этой статье.

Ниже приведены несколько забавных фрагментов.

У нас есть решение проблемы курицы и яйца! CoPilot понимает свои ограничения и передает научные вопросы в «Science AI».

В этом простом тесте CoPilot показался довольно умным. Он отказался показать какие-либо предпочтения между Джоном и Мэри в первых нескольких вопросах и просто выбрал первый вариант.
Из-за моих частых вопросов о программистах он научился часто производить такой вывод. Означает ли это, что CoPilot будет имитировать пользователя?
Наконец, CoPilot просто отказался предлагать что-либо в последнем вопросе. Это умный ход ИИ? Посмотрим.

Через некоторое время общение с CoPilot стало повторяющимся, думаю, мне следует придерживаться кодирования.

Команда CoPilot много сделала для борьбы с предвзятым, дискриминационным или оскорбительным содержанием. Как упоминалось на их веб-сайте, они приняли соответствующие превентивные меры и попросили тестировщиков отмечать любые такие случаи.